A leading and growing Manchester-based fashion womenswear supplier is seeking a Junior Womenswear Fashion Designer to join their dynamic and fast-paced womenswear design team. This is an exciting opportunity for a commercially minded womenswear high street designer who loves high street trend-led fashion and wants to grow within a supportive, collaborative environment.
What You’ll Do:
- Design on trend high street womenswear for a number of high street retailers in a growing team
- Research trends and contribute fresh, forward-thinking design ideas
- Create mood boards, CAD designs and develop themed ranges
- Work closely with design, sales, buying and production teams
- Support sampling, fabric/trim selection and prototype development
- Assist in organising samples and maintaining showroom newness
What We’re Looking For:
- Previous and recent experience as womenswear designer of high street fashion, must be young fashion though and grounded
- Strong CAD skills and a great eye for fabrics, colour and print
- Creativity, commercial awareness and a proactive mindset
- Excellent communication, teamwork and organisational skills
- Manchester based and eligible to work in the UK
What’s On Offer:
- Exposure to major UK retailers
- Hands-on experience across the full design process
- Opportunities for development and progression
- A friendly, creative team environment
- Hybrid working – 1 day per week from home after probation
